Bay City Western High School Overview

About This School

Bay City Western High School is a public high in Auburn, Michigan, serving 1,009 students in grades 9-12. The school maintains a staff of 42 teachers with an average salary of $70,173 and a student-teacher ratio of 23:1. Guidance services are provided through a ratio of 336 students per counselor. Students at the school represent a diverse demographic, with 54% male and 46% female enrollment. The student body is 89% White, 5% Hispanic, 3% Two or More Races, 1% Asian, and 1% Black.
